Default Paypal don't protect ya

Grrr big rant - bought some GHD hair straighteners from flea bay for £75, only £20 cheaper than stockist so figured they'd be ok. Came to register them with GHD and nope they are fake.

So I start a dispute with Paypal and ebay, ebay have already worked out this guy is a fraudster and he is no longer registered, paypal start the dispute. Summat like 60 days for the seller to respond, I am waiting and waiting from Paypal and hear nothing.

Then I get "you have 10 days to prove they are fake, get a letter ferom GHD". SO i call GHD who say I have to send the product to them and they will write a report, could take months, so I call paypal who say "oh no don't send them thru the post as this in itself is an offence, go to your hairdresser or authority who can say they are fake". SO I go to my hairdresser who actually sell them and use them and they write me a letter, which I fax to Paypal - job done !

Nope, as the letter is not on letterhead then this doesnt count, although it has the name and address and phone number of the hairdresser, so they could call. I phone paypal who record my quarms as they give me 3 days now to get a letter on letterhead. Arrrrhhhhh.

I come home to another email, we need it on letter head ot you can go to your police station and they will give you a crime number for us. But as I am a piggy wiggy I know they don't, they tell ya to go to the ebay fraud team (who didnt want to know). SO i tell paypal this and they still want a letterheaded piece of paper.

Long and short of it I lost my £75 cause paypal can't be ar$ed to make a phone call but they can send emails til they wear their fingers away tellin me what to do.

Grrrrr I shall not be using flea bay or paypal again, they having no more of my money!

Rant over

Quote:
Originally Posted by Shellywoozle View Post

Didnt pay on credit card, was on a debit card.

There is still some protection with a debit card if it is visa debit. Maestro is pants though. With visa debit you can do a chargeback. Working lunch been on about it all week, maybe more info on their website
